The Native American Development Corporation (NADC) mission isto provide resources and tools to help individuals, families, businesses, and communities in Native American areas thrive.The NADC's mission is to help people achieve economic and social stability through : Technical assistance, Business lending, Health and wellness, and Entrepreneurial advocacy and support.
We're looking for a professional full-time Chief Financial Officer who will oversee the financial activities of the organization, while leading and developing the finance team. This individual will work closely with the CEO, COO, and Board of Directors to advise on acquisitions, teaming arrangements, feasibility, profitability, sustainability and investments.
Responsibilities
- Oversee the finance department to ensure proper maintenance of all accounting systems and functions, supervise NADC finance staff, oversee budgeting, financial forecasting, and cash flow for administration, existing programs, and proposed new sites.
- Appraises the organizations financial position and issues periodic reports on organizations financial stability, liquidity, and growth.
- Directs the preparation of financial reports for various needs, summarizing and estimating NADCs financial position with such as income statements, balance sheets and analysis of future earnings and income
- Coordinates tax reporting programs and investor relations activities with NADC for profit entities.
- Analyzes consolidates and directs all cost accounting procedures together with other statistical and routine reports.
- Develop and utilize forward-looking, predictive models and activity-based financial analyzes to provide insight into the organizations operations and business plans.
- Develop financial business plan and forecasts review and approve preparation and finalizations of monthly and annual financial reporting materials and metrics for NADCs Board of Directors.
- Engage the BOD to develop short medium and long-tern financial plans and projections in coordination with CEO.
